Zip code 08511 (Fort Dix, New Jersey) is classified as a White Majority community with moderate diversity as of 2022. The area has a population of 944 and a median income of $104,731.
Fort Dix has experienced shifts in its racial composition over the past decade. In 2013, the white population was 73%, indicating low diversity. By 2022, the white population decreased to 54%, signifying a transition to moderate diversity. The Black population increased from 10% in 2013 to 26% in 2022, while the Hispanic population grew from 11% to 18% during the same period.
The median income in Fort Dix fluctuated over time. It peaked at $103,300 in 2013, declined to $85,165 in 2017, and then increased to $104,731 in 2022. The population decreased from 1,501 in 2010 to 928 in 2021, before slightly increasing to 944 in 2022.
